If you're having trouble logging in to or using the Motion Array Hub, try the troubleshooting steps below.

1. Check your login method

The Motion Array Hub uses the same login method as the Motion Array website.

For example:

  • If you created your account using Google, sign in using Continue with Google.
  • If you created your account using Apple, sign in using Continue with Apple.
  • If you use an email address and password, make sure you're entering the correct credentials.

If you've forgotten your password, reset it and try signing in again.

2. Check your internet connection

Make sure you have a stable internet connection.

If possible, try connecting to a different network, such as a mobile hotspot, to rule out any network-related issues.

3. Disable your VPN, firewall, or antivirus

Temporarily disable any VPN, firewall, or antivirus software that may be preventing the Hub from connecting, then try again.

4. If you're seeing a "Failed to write to file" error (Mac)

This error usually means the Adobe Extensions folder is missing or doesn't have the correct permissions.

Check the Extensions folder

  1. Open Finder.
  2. Select Go from the menu bar.
  3. Hold the Option key and select Library.
  4. Navigate to:

Application Support > Adobe > CEP > extensions

If the extensions folder doesn't exist, create it.

Check folder permissions

  1. Right-click the extensions folder and select Get Info.
  2. Expand Sharing & Permissions.
  3. Ensure your user account has Read & Write access.
  4. If needed:
    • Click the lock icon and enter your Mac password.
    • Change your permissions to Read & Write.
    • Click the gear icon and select Apply to enclosed items.

Once complete, try the installation again.
